Worm Food is a boss-summoning item used to summon the Eater of Worlds. Worm Food can only be used in the Corruption or Underground Corruption, and attempting to use it outside of the Corruption will have no effect and will not consume it. From terraria.wiki.gg
Worm Food is a boss-summoning item used to summon the Eater of Worlds. It can be used at any time of day, but only inside the Corruption. Although the Crimson is considered a counterpart to the Corruption, using Worm Food in the Crimson will not do anything. From terraria.fandom.com
